求最小公倍数方法如下:
(1)、两数相乘法。
如果两个数是互质数。那么它们的最小公倍数就是这两个数的乘积。例如:4和7的最小公倍数就是4×7=28。
(2)、找大数法。
如果两个数有倍数关系。那么较大的数就是这两个数的最小公倍数。例如:3和15的最小公倍数就是较大数15。
(3)、扩大法
如果两数不是互质,也没有倍数关系时,可以把较大数依次扩大2倍、3倍、……看扩大到哪个数时最先成为较小数的倍数时,这个数就是这两个数的最小公倍数。例如:18和30的最小公倍数,就是把30扩大2倍得60,60不是18的倍数;再把30扩大3倍得90,90是18的倍数,那么90就是18和30的最小公倍数。
(4)、两数的乘积再除以两数的最大公约数法。
这个方法虽然比较复杂,但是使用范围很广。因为两个数的乘积等于这两个数的最大公约数和最小公倍数的乘积。例如:4和6的最大公约数是2,最小公倍数是12,那么,4×6=2×12。为了便于口算,我们可以把两个数中的任意一个数先除以它们的最大公约数,然后再和另一个数相乘。例如:18和30的最大公约数是6,要求18和30的最小公倍数时,可以先用18除以6得3,再用3和30相乘得90;或者先用30除以6得5,再用5和18相乘得90。这90就是18和30的最小公倍数
分享到:
相关推荐
7-3 最大公约数和最小公倍数
python求最大公约数和最小公倍数 #辗转相除法 def gcd(a,b): #最大公约数函数,且最小公倍数 = 两个数相乘 / 最大公约数 if b == 0: return a else: return gcd(b,a%b) print("请输入两个数:") j,k = input()....
实现求两个整数的最大公约数和最小公倍数。求两个数的最大公约数和最小公倍数的方法有很多种,常用的有欧几里得算法和Stein算法。
关于如何求最大公约数和最小公倍数的c语言程序
python 输入两个正整数计算最大公约数和最小公倍数 示例
用LabVIEW求最大公约数和最小公倍数。可以自行选择数据。
Java基础编程题:求最大公约数和最小公倍数问题
最大公约数、最小公倍数 * 最大公约数(a,b) * 12的因数:1、2、3、4、6、12 * 18的因数:1、2、3、6、9、18 * 12和18的最大公约数——6 * 最小公倍数[a,b] * A=2*3*7 * B=2*5*7 * AB的最小公倍数——2*3*5*7...
计算最大公约数和最小公倍数的常见算法计算最大公约数和最小公倍数的常见算法计算最大公约数和最小公倍数的常见算法计算最大公约数和最小公倍数的常见算法计算最大公约数和最小公倍数的常见算法计算最大公约数和最小...
基于FPGA开发板的两位数求最大公约数和最小公倍数的设计,该设计中利用辗转相减法求得公约数与公倍数,且两个数的数值可通过按键修改,设计灵活可靠。该设计基于vivado开发,并带有testbench文件,方便仿真学习。
Java求最大公约数、最小公倍数,输入两个正整数m和n,求其最大公约数和最小公倍数。最小公倍数可由原数除以最大公约数计算得到,这里使用了辗除法。
求最大公约数和最小公倍数. 相信你们会找到的。
用碾压法求出两个数的最大公因数,然后将剩下的分子连乘再乘以最大公因数即可获得最小公倍数
最大公约数最小公倍数
JAVA实现求最大公约数和最小公倍数 根据欧几里得定律,最大公约数的递归算法
求两个整数的最大公约数和最小公倍数的C语言方法
输出m,n的最大公约数和最小公倍数,大家共同学习。
1.最小公倍数、最大公约数1.最小公倍数、最大公约数1.最小公倍数、最大公约数
求最大公约数和最小公倍数的程序,求两个整数的最大公约数和最小公倍数!